Frightful and Fatal Explosion.

DETROIT, January 11.—The store and stock of groceries, &c., of J. P. Andrews & Co., at Climax, Kalamazoo county, were blown all to pieces last evening by the explosion of 100 pounds of powder. Twelve persons were injured, nine very badly. The loss on the building is $1,000, and on stock $2,000. The clerk was weighing out some powder for a customer, when by some unaccountable accident the powder became ignited and the explosion followed. It is a miracle that nobody was killed outright.

Chas. Gould, Clerk, John Shaffer, the customer who had bought the powder, and Wm. Vanvalkenburg, a laborer, who were standing by, were so badly injured that they will probably die.
